Abstract:The paper assessed the extent to which the training and learning process of civil artisans under vocational education and training meets civil construction employers’ demanded competencies. Data were collected from trainers, learners, employees and employers through semi-structured interviews and structured questionnaires. A qualitative exploratory approach was deployed by using MAXQDA2020 software. Content analysis was used to analyze documents and interview transcripts.
